It had been a long time since Betanzos had faced flooding like the ones that occurred on Friday afternoon. In fact, the Os Caneiros field, located three kilometers from the urban center, was completely flooded, the Mendo river also went out of bounds in the Paseo de la Tolerancia, where one of the stormwater sewers overflowed, leaving the impassable road throughout the area. And the area of ​​the port was also covered by the river, affecting several cars as well as two ships, one of them used as a gym. The Betanzos Council confirmed that these floods have nothing to do with the pumping system in the A Ribeira area, but rather an abnormal rise in the Mendo riverbed.

In this sense, the municipal technicians explained that there were several circumstances that caused the overflow of the river course: There was a full moon, which caused the spring tides. In this way, the sea entered the estuary more than normal, creating a kind of barrier that did not allow the river to evacuate the water. In fact, the entire area of ​​Os Caneiros was flooded by the high tide. The tide was high, they insisted. They indicated that the rain that fell throughout this week could also have affected the level of water carried by the Mendo River.

A specific problem

In any case, from the local government they assured that it was a specific problem, coinciding with the time of high tide and that, unlike on previous occasions, these floods did not affect homes or commercial establishments.

In 2019, after decades of waiting, the State carried out the improvement works in A Ribeira with which the floods that affected the road and the residents of this neighborhood were avoided. The project, which was undertaken by the Ministry of Public Works and in which it invested 980,000 euros, involved the creation of a drainage network complementary to the previously existing one to prevent the entry of seawater through the existing installation and to conduct rainwater to the pumping well during the periods of high tides or floods of the Mandeo. It also contemplated the renewal of the drain network on the inner side of the road with the installation of non-return valves. At the same time, the City Council of Betanzos managing the total renovation of the sidewalks.
